A male victim is fighting for his life after being stabbed in Mississauga on Friday afternoon.

The incident happened around 3 p.m. in the area of Indian Grove and Indian Road. Police say an altercation occurred inside a residence before the stabbing.

Speaking to reporters at the scene, Peel Regional Police Acting Insp. Matt Miller said officers arrived to find a male victim suffering from multiple “lacerations.”

“Officers and other emergency services performed life-saving measures.”

The victim was taken to a local hospital, where his injuries are currently considered life-threatening.

Police arrested a 17-year-old male suspect at the scene, who will be charged with attempted murder, according to Miller.

“There is no current evidence to support that any other parties are outstanding in this event,” Miller said.

Miller said the suspect and victim knew each other at the time of the incident.

“I can say at this point that the relationship is familial, but I don’t know the exact nature of the relationship,” he said.

Indian Grove Road is currently closed as police continue their investigation.
